Budgeting Basics
Creating a budget is essential for managing finances in Boscobel:
- Track your income and expenses: Use apps or spreadsheets to monitor where your money goes.
- Set realistic goals: Prioritize needs over wants to maintain financial health.
Affordable Living Options
Consider these options to reduce living costs in Boscobel:
- Housing: Look for rentals or homes in neighborhoods with lower average rents.
- Public transportation: Utilize local transit options to save on transportation costs.
- Shared resources: Co-housing or sharing expenses with roommates can lower bills.
Grocery Savings
Grocery shopping efficiently can greatly impact your budget:
- Plan meals: Create a weekly meal plan to avoid impulse purchases.
- Use coupons and discounts: Take advantage of sales and loyalty programs at local stores.
- Buy in bulk: Purchase non-perishable items in bulk to save money over time.

How can I minimize my utility bills in Boscobel?
Minimizing utility bills can be achieved by being energy-efficient, such as using LED bulbs, unplugging devices when not in use, and conserving water. Checking for local energy assistance programs can also help reduce costs.
